#5461da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5461da is composed of 32.9% red, 38%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.5% cyan, 55.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 234.2 degrees, a saturation of 64.4% and a lightness of 59.2%. #5461da color hex could be obtained by blending #a8c2ff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#5461da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010206 is the darkest color, while #f5f6fd is the lightest one.
